Job description

Your Role

Due to increased project wins in the UK and Europe, Gensler’s London Studio is seeking a Project Architect to join our growing team. The Project Architect is an integral part of the team who specialise in the Retail & Lifestyle sector. You will be experienced in handling the technical process, with excellent communication and team relationship skills, and the ability to understand and interpret client, designer and contractor’s needs and requirements. It will be your role to lead the team through the delivery of a variety of project types, sizes, across all phases.

As Project Architect/Design Manager at Gensler, your role will be characterised by the 5 essential components: Client Engagement, Contract Compliance, Business of Design, Process Definition and Team Integration. This includes but is not limited to serving as the main point of contact for the client through the project design and delivery phases; managing the internal and external processes; and building efficient project teams while mentoring junior staff to encourage the highest level of design and client satisfaction.

What You Will Do

As a Project Architect, you will tap into your boundless creativity to design unique professional environments, providing technical support for completion and execution of projects, working on all project stages.

  • You will be capable of managing multiple projects simultaneously working with the team to design and deliver major projects for clients.
  • Experience in the design and delivery of Retail & Hospitality architecture projects is essential.
  • Develop and nurture positive relationships with existing client contacts, optimising all potential opportunities.
  • Maintain an awareness of existing clients’ business objectives, plans, target audience and market trends, and ensure that appropriate opportunities are identified to generate further demand for Gensler services.
  • Prepare and review proposals, contracts and consultant agreements.
  • Manage project lifecycle; estimating, bidding, project kick-off, weekly coordination, punch list, turnover, opening, and project close-out.
  • Support communication between project team, clients, vendors, contractors, consultants, and building and permitting officials.
  • Provide technical guidance and innovative solutions to resolve complex technical and design challenges.
  • Maintain project manual and specifications.
  • Conduct and document site visits, process submittals, substitution requests, and RFI’s during construction.
  • Focus on the smooth management of the project process, ensuring clarity of requirements, deliverables, timelines, and visibility against fees through the project life cycle.
  • Manage multiple aspects of client, team and project coordination, including full documentation with structural, MEP, lighting, AV, landscape, civil and other consultants.
  • Actively take ownership of problems and successful resolution planning in consultation with our Retail Leadership and Studio Leader.
  • Support and contribute to new business development with both current and potential clients.
  • Contribute positively to Project reports and staffing meetings with concise and accurate information to continually improve the studio’s delivery and financial objectives.
  • Review internal project accounting documents and process draft project billing.
  • Work with the Design Director and the marketing team to ensure that the project story is documented and that photography/videography is arranged, as needed.

Your Qualifications

  • RIBA or ARB registered Architect; preferably with experience in the Lifestyle/Hospitality/Retail industry.
  • Experience in project leadership, excellent client liaison and team management skills.
  • Experience with the full project lifecycle, through to delivery.
  • Knowledge and experience in all phases of interior design / architectural projects.
  • Knowledge of UK building regulations, standards and building structures.
  • Ability to develop collaborative relationships across the firm, with clients, and with other key constituents.
  • Ability to understand how buildings are constructed and to create technical documents that succinctly describe the work to be done.
  • Experience managing consultant teams and resolving technical and design issues.
  • Strong leadership, organizational, communication and relationship-management skills.
  • High level of design competence with knowledge of building codes.
  • Proficiency in Revit desirable.
